\ˈhəˈku'nə-'mə'fʌk'ɪt\
│huh-koo-nuh muh-fuhk-it│
The phrase is derived from the Swahilian phrase "hakuna matata", which translated
literally means "there are no problems", and the English phrase "fuck it".
:to quit or be done with something that was giving you worries or problems.
:to not put up with anyone or anything's (bull)shit or
drama anymore
Hakuna Mafuckit is a wonderful phrase and a problem-free
philosophy that promotes a very chill, laid-back, anti-dramatic type of atmosphere.
